           Att which day here Came the Parties afd. by their Attorneys afd. And hereupon the Said Mary and
William Ennalls declared Against the afd. Christopher Piper in the plea afd. in form following
Somerset fst Christopher Piper Late of Somerset County Planter Otherwise Called I Christopher Piper of Somerset
County in the Province of Maryland Planter was Summoned to Answer unto Mary Ennalls Executrix and William
Ennalls Executor of the Testament and Last Will of Joseph Ennalls of Dorchester County deceased of A plea that he
Render unto them the Sum of forty Six Pounds Eleven Shillings and Six pence Curt Money of Maryland which from
them he unjustly detains and So forth
           And Whereupon the Said Mary and William by George Hayward their Attorney Say that whereas the Said
Christopher on the Twenty third day of July Anno Dom. MDCCLVii at Dorchester County to wit at Somerset County
afd. by his Certain Writing Obligatory Sealed with the Seal of the Said Christopher and to the Court here Shown the date
Whereof is the day and Year afd. Acknowledged himself to be held and firmly Bound to the Said Joseph in his
Lifetime in the afd. Sum of forty Six Pounds Eleven Shillings and Six pence Curt Money of Maryland to be paid to the
Said Joseph when he the Said Christopher Should be thereto afterwards Required Nevertheless the Said
Christopher the afd. Sum of Forty Six Pounds Eleven Shillings and Six pence Curt Money afd. altho often Required
to the Said Joseph in his Lifetime or to the Said Mary and William after the death of the Said Joseph or to
Either of them hath not yet Paid but the Same Christopher the afd. Sum of Forty Six Pounds Eleven Shillings and
Six Pence Curt Money afd. to the Said Joseph in his Lifetime and to the Said Mary and William after the death
of the Said Joseph hath hitherto Altogether denyed to pay and the Same to the Said Mary and William or
to Either of them doth Yet deny to pay to the Damage of the Said Mary and William Forty Six Pounds
Eleven Shillings and Six Pence Curt Money of Maryland and thereof they bring Suit and So forth and the
Said Mary and William bring here to Court the Letters Testamentary of the afd. Joseph by Which it
Sufficiently Appears to the Court here that the Said Mary is Executrix and the Said William Executor of the Last will
And Testament of the Said Joseph afd. and thereof hath the Administration
                                                                                                Pledges &c. J. Doe & R. Roe
           And the afd. Christopher Piper by his Attorney afd. Comes and defends the force and Injury when &c And
prays Leave thereof to Imparle here untill next Court to be held at Princes Ann Town the third Tuesday of August
then next following and he hath it and the Same day is Given to the afd. Mary and William Exrs. here Also &c
           Att which day here Came as well the afd. Ch Mary and William Exrs. as afd. As the afd. Christopher
by their Attorneys afd. and hereupon the Said Christopher prays further Leave thereof to Imparle here untill
Next Court to be held at Princes Ann Town the third Tuesday of November then next following and he hath
it and the Same day is Given to the afd. Exrs. here also &c
           Att which day here Came as well the afd. Mary and William Exrs. afd. as the afd. Christopher
by their Attorneys afd. And hereupon the Said Christopher as before defends the force and Injury when &c.
And Saith that he Cannot deny the Action afd. of the afd. Mary and William nor but that the Writing Obligatory
afd. is the deed of him the Said Christopher nor but that he detains from the afd. Mary and William the afd. forty
Six Pounds Eleven Shillings and Six Pence Curt Money in Manner and form as the afd. Mary and William above Against
him have Declared    Therefore it is Considered that the afd. Mary and William Ennalls Recover Against the
afd. Christopher Piper his debt afd. and his Damages by Occasion of the detention of the Same debt to
307:                                     Pounds of Tobacco the Same Mary and William of their Assent by the Court
here Adjudged And the afd. Christopher in Mercy &c
